Transaction 0f31c778bc8d77ec10b95a3ace054cc20d8407afe4e981208099a422208d2543

34 Input
2 Outputs
  • 0f31c778bc8d77ec10b95a3ace054cc20d8407afe4e981208099a422208d2543:0
  • value  8497859
    address  3PGaHFjGmvQGk1qRRmok3Jz9FcXXLtpVdS
  • 0f31c778bc8d77ec10b95a3ace054cc20d8407afe4e981208099a422208d2543:1
  • value  46881
    address  3EVkH9nC4ftJeU1Mesdu3WjrPYTyKtmV2J